    Gentamycin produced domestically matches international standards in antibacterial activity and spectrum. A new agar-diffusion method effectively measures gentamycin

    Area of Science:

    • Microbiology
    • Pharmacology

    Background:

    • Gentamycin is a crucial antibiotic for treating bacterial infections.
    • Ensuring consistent quality and efficacy of gentamycin is vital for patient care.

    Purpose of the Study:

    • To compare the antibacterial properties of domestically produced gentamycin with international samples.
    • To develop and validate a reliable method for assessing gentamycin's activity.

    Main Methods:

    • Comparative analysis of antibacterial spectrum and activity levels.
    • Development of an agar-diffusion assay using Bacillus pumilus NTCC 8241.
    • Evaluation of gentamycin sulfate complex and its components.

    Main Results:

    • Domestic gentamycin demonstrated comparable antibacterial spectrum and activity to international counterparts.

  • Gentamycin showed significant efficacy against Pseudomonas aeruginosa, outperforming carbenicillin but slightly less than polymyxin.
  • The developed agar-diffusion method proved effective for determining gentamycin activity.
  • Gentamycin sulfate complex and its individual components exhibited similar activity, spectrum, and diffusion characteristics.
  • Conclusions:

    • Domestic gentamycin production meets international quality benchmarks.
    • The novel agar-diffusion method offers a reliable means for gentamycin quality control.
    • Understanding the comparative efficacy of gentamycin against other antibiotics aids in clinical decision-making.
